4.4k Aufrufe
Gefragt in WindowsVista von snoopie Experte (3.2k Punkte)
Ich habe folgendes Problem mit dem DVB-T-TV-Empfang mittels Windows Media Center:

Die nach einem Sendersuchlauf gespeicherten und dann in die richtige Reihenfolge sortierten Empfangskanäle geraten trotz Speicherung irgendwann in ihrer Reihenfolge durcheinander. Zunächst wurde vermutet, dass dieses Problem nur bei Verwendung der Fernbedienung auftritt, aber es zeigt sich nun, dass der Fehler auch bei Kanalauswahl über die PC-Tastatur auftreten kann.

Daher möchte ich gerne die einmal in richtigerr Reihenfolge gespeicherten Kanäle als Backup in einer Datei speichern,
um sie gegebenenfalls einfach zurückspielen zu können. Leider habe ich bisher trotz umfangreicher Versuche noch
nicht herausfinden können, wo das Media Center die Daten speichert.

Gibt es hier zufällig jemanden, der mir diesbezüglich auf die Sprünge helfen kann?

Details zum Equipment:
Medion Notebook MD 98200, Windows Vista Home Premium
DVB-T Tuner-Karte CTX 975 mit lt. Medion aktuellem Treiber
Software: Windows Media Center

Danke im voraus für hilfreiche Tipps.

Snoopie

6 Antworten

0 Punkte
Beantwortet von kjg17 Profi (34.4k Punkte)
Hallo Snoopie,

eventuell kann dir KB 938927 bei der grundsätzlichen Lösung des Problemes helfen. Dann wäre das mit den Sicherungen überflüssig.

Gruß
Kalle
0 Punkte
Beantwortet von snoopie Experte (3.2k Punkte)
Hallo Kalle,

vielen Dank für den Hinweis.

Habe die Info soeben erstmals überflogen, werde das Ganze noch im Detail durcharbeiten.

Vielleicht hilft´s ja tatsächlich. Die Hoffnung ist allerdings nicht allzu gross, weil der betroffene PC bisher eigentlich immer lückenlos per Online-Update durch Microsoft auf dem aktuellen Stand gehalten wird. Und hätte doch eigentlich der Hotfix dabei sein müssen.

Das Dumme bei dem Problem ist, dass es nur sporadisch auftritt. Wie erwähnt, zunächst hatte ich die Fernbedienung im Verdacht und habe sie weggelassen. Da war dann mehrere Monate lang Ruhe. Aber jetzt trat das Problem wieder auf, als ich versuchsweise alle gespeicherten Kanäle per Tastatur der Reihe nach aufrief. Sie kamen alle auf der richtigen Nummer, nur als ich dann von #25 auf #2 zurückwollte, war plötzlich wieder mal alles durcheinander.

Es kann nun durchaus sein, dass das Problem wieder über einen längeren Zeitraum verschwunden bleibt, egal ob mit oder ohne Hotfix-Versuch. Daher denke ich, dass ein Backup der verantwortlichen Dateien vielleicht das Beste wäre. Fragt sich eben nur, welche Dateien das sind ...

Gruss und nochmals danke,

Snoopie.
0 Punkte
Beantwortet von kjg17 Profi (34.4k Punkte)
Hallo Snoopie,

die Kanaleinstellungen sollen dem Vernehmen nach in einer Datenbank abgelegt sein, zumindest wurde das im www im Zusammenhang mit Updates der MediaCenter-Software erwähnt.
C:\ ProgramData\ Microsoft\ eHome\ mcepg1-0.db

Ob man die einfach so sichern und wieder zurückspielen kann, dazu habe ich auf Anhieb keine konkrete Aussage finden können, eventuell recherchierst du selbst noch mal.

Gruß
Kalle
0 Punkte
Beantwortet von snoopie Experte (3.2k Punkte)
Hallo Kalle,

danke für den neuen Hinweis, dem ich auch gleich nachgegangen bin.

Allerdings finde ich auf dem betroffenen Vista-Notebook trotz intensiver Suche die angegebene Datenbank nicht. Ich habe daraufhin mal mit der Bezeichnung gegoogelt und dabei herausgefunden, dass ich wohl nicht der Einzige mit diesem Problem bin. In einem Forum "MCE-Community.de" fand ich einige Hinweise. Aber es scheint auch, als wenn diese Datenbank nur unter XP so heisst und ein Equivalent unter Vista wahrscheinlich einen anderen Namen hat.

Naja, ich werde nebenbei ein wenig in dieser Sache weiterstochern, es eilt ja nicht (in der Hoffnung, dass der Fehler wieder mal einige Zeit wegbleibt). Und es sind ja nur etwa 25 Kanäle, in dem erwähnten Forum kämpft da jemand mit über 4000 (!).

Gruss,
Snoopie
0 Punkte
Beantwortet von snoopie Experte (3.2k Punkte)
Hallo Kalle!

Ich bin etwas weitergekommen und habe inzwischen die Datei

c:\ProgramData\Microsoft\ehome\EPG\prefs\prefs.xml

entdeckt. Diese, auch als Textfile mit dem Editor lesbare,
Datei enthält in aufsteigender Reihenfolge der zugewiesenen
Kanalnummern Daten zu den einzelnen TV-Sendern.

Hier ein kurzer Ausschnitt:

<lineups schema_version="1.1" client_version="2.0" originalCreator="MCE 2.0" copyright="Copyright Microsoft Corp. All

rights reserved." x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<lineup sources="1767511943">
<sources>
<s headend="" headendname="" supplierid="" suppliername="" supplierinfo=""

hnt="HEADEND_NETWORK_TYPE_UNK" regiontuningcode="" currentversion="0" id="1654769127" language=""

schemaversion="" unmapped="False" restricted="False">
<copyright>
</copyright>
</s>
</sources>
<tuneRequests ct="0" />
<presets ct="33">
<p number="1">
<s name="Das Erste" call_sign="Das Erste" affiliation="" id="602000:8468:38912:1" virtualchannelnumber="0"

GuideService="1" TuningService="1" sourceId="1654769127" />
</p>
<p number="2">
<s name="ZDF" call_sign="ZDF" affiliation="" id="482000:8468:514:514" virtualchannelnumber="0"

GuideService="1" TuningService="1" sourceId="1654769127" />
</p>
<p number="3">
<s name="SWR Fernsehen RP" call_sign="SWR Fernsehen RP" affiliation="" id="198500:8468:17920:226"

virtualchannelnumber="0" GuideService="1" TuningService="1" sourceId="1654769127" />
</p>

... usw.

Unter "p name" findet man die Kanalnummer, unter "s name"
den Stationsnamen und die ersten drei Ziffern der "id" geben
die Empfangsfrequenz in MHz an.

Vertausche ich nun mit dem im Media Center dafür vorgesehenen Ferature z.B. die Kanäle 1 und 2, ändert sich deren Reihenfolge auch in der bewussten Datei.

Allerdings werden dabei anscheinend auch noch weitere Dateien, hinter deren Sinn ich noch nicht gekommen bin, geändert. Auf alle Fälle habe ich die Datei erstmal als Backup gesichert und werde sie beim nächsten Auftreten des Fehlers versuchsweise zurückspielen.

Solange ich nicht weiss, was die anderen sich ändernden Dateien bezwecken, möchte ich von einer versuchsweisen manuellen Änderung der prefs.xml-Datei noch Abstand nehmen.

Gruss,
Snoopie
0 Punkte
Beantwortet von snoopie Experte (3.2k Punkte)
Nachtrag:

Googeln mit prefs.xml brachte inzwischen recht aufschlussreiche Erkenntnisse:

Das Problem mit der verlorenen Kanalsortierung scheint schon alt zu sein, es trat vor Jahren schon unter Win XP auf. Eine echte Lösung des Problems scheint es bisher nicht zu geben. Und in einem australischen Forum wird berichtet, dass ein einfaches Kopieren und zurückkopieren der Datei prefs.xml nicht ausreicht, weil tatsächlich weitere Dateien im Spiel sind.

Ich werde mich wohl damit abfinden müssen, dass ich von Zeit zu Zeit die Kanäle neu sortieren muss.

Snoopie
...